  1. #!/usr/bin/env bash
  2. set -o pipefail
  3. if [[ "$(uname -r)" =~ ^4\.15\.0-60 ]]; then
  4. echo "DO NOT RUN mailcow ON THIS UBUNTU KERNEL!";
  5. echo "Please update to 5.x or use another distribution."
  6. exit 1
  7. fi
  8. if [[ "$(uname -r)" =~ ^4\.4\. ]]; then
  9. if grep -q Ubuntu <<< $(uname -a); then
  10. echo "DO NOT RUN mailcow ON THIS UBUNTU KERNEL!";
  11. echo "Please update to linux-generic-hwe-16.04 by running \"apt-get install --install-recommends linux-generic-hwe-16.04\""
  12. exit 1
  13. fi
  14. fi
  15. if grep --help 2>&1 | head -n 1 | grep -q -i "busybox"; then echo "BusyBox grep detected, please install gnu grep, \"apk add --no-cache --upgrade grep\""; exit 1; fi
  16. # This will also cover sort
  17. if cp --help 2>&1 | head -n 1 | grep -q -i "busybox"; then echo "BusyBox cp detected, please install coreutils, \"apk add --no-cache --upgrade coreutils\""; exit 1; fi
  18. if sed --help 2>&1 | head -n 1 | grep -q -i "busybox"; then echo "BusyBox sed detected, please install gnu sed, \"apk add --no-cache --upgrade sed\""; exit 1; fi
  19. for bin in openssl curl docker git awk sha1sum; do
  20. if [[ -z $(which ${bin}) ]]; then echo "Cannot find ${bin}, exiting..."; exit 1; fi
  21. done
  22. if docker compose > /dev/null 2>&1; then
  23. if docker compose version --short | grep "^2." > /dev/null 2>&1; then
  24. COMPOSE_VERSION=native
  25. echo -e "\e[31mFound Docker Compose Plugin (native).\e[0m"
  26. echo -e "\e[31mSetting the DOCKER_COMPOSE_VERSION Variable to native\e[0m"
  27. sleep 2
  28. echo -e "\e[33mNotice: You´ll have to update this Compose Version via your Package Manager manually!\e[0m"
  29. else
  30. echo -e "\e[31mCannot find Docker Compose with a Version Higher than 2.X.X.\e[0m"
  31. echo -e "\e[31mPlease update it manually regarding to this doc site: https://mailcow.github.io/mailcow-dockerized-docs/i_u_m/i_u_m_install/\e[0m"
  32. exit 1
  33. fi
  34. elif docker-compose > /dev/null 2>&1; then
  35. if ! [[ $(alias docker-compose 2> /dev/null) ]] ; then
  36. if docker-compose version --short | grep "^2." > /dev/null 2>&1; then
  37. COMPOSE_VERSION=standalone
  38. echo -e "\e[31mFound Docker Compose Standalone.\e[0m"
  39. echo -e "\e[31mSetting the DOCKER_COMPOSE_VERSION Variable to standalone\e[0m"
  40. sleep 2
  41. echo -e "\e[33mNotice: You´ll have to update this Compose Version manually! Please see: https://mailcow.github.io/mailcow-dockerized-docs/i_u_m/i_u_m_install/\e[0m"
  42. else
  43. echo -e "\e[31mCannot find Docker Compose with a Version Higher than 2.X.X.\e[0m"
  44. echo -e "\e[31mPlease update manually regarding to this doc site: https://mailcow.github.io/mailcow-dockerized-docs/i_u_m/i_u_m_install/\e[0m"
  45. exit 1
  46. fi
  47. fi
  48. else
  49. echo -e "\e[31mCannot find Docker Compose.\e[0m"
  50. echo -e "\e[31mPlease install it regarding to this doc site: https://mailcow.github.io/mailcow-dockerized-docs/i_u_m/i_u_m_install/\e[0m"
  51. exit 1
  52. fi
  53. if [ -f mailcow.conf ]; then
  54. read -r -p "A config file exists and will be overwritten, are you sure you want to continue? [y/N] " response
  55. case $response in
  56. [yY][eE][sS]|[yY])
  57. mv mailcow.conf mailcow.conf_backup
  58. chmod 600 mailcow.conf_backup
  59. ;;
  60. *)
  61. exit 1
  62. ;;
  63. esac
  64. fi
  65. echo "Press enter to confirm the detected value '[value]' where applicable or enter a custom value."
  66. while [ -z "${MAILCOW_HOSTNAME}" ]; do
  67. read -p "Mail server hostname (FQDN) - this is not your mail domain, but your mail servers hostname: " -e MAILCOW_HOSTNAME
  68. DOTS=${MAILCOW_HOSTNAME//[^.]};
  69. if [ ${#DOTS} -lt 2 ] && [ ! -z ${MAILCOW_HOSTNAME} ]; then
  70. echo "${MAILCOW_HOSTNAME} is not a FQDN"
  71. MAILCOW_HOSTNAME=
  72. fi
  73. done
  74. if [ -a /etc/timezone ]; then
  75. DETECTED_TZ=$(cat /etc/timezone)
  76. elif [ -a /etc/localtime ]; then
  77. DETECTED_TZ=$(readlink /etc/localtime|sed -n 's|^.*zoneinfo/||p')
  78. fi
  79. while [ -z "${MAILCOW_TZ}" ]; do
  80. if [ -z "${DETECTED_TZ}" ]; then
  81. read -p "Timezone: " -e MAILCOW_TZ
  82. else
  83. read -p "Timezone [${DETECTED_TZ}]: " -e MAILCOW_TZ
  84. [ -z "${MAILCOW_TZ}" ] && MAILCOW_TZ=${DETECTED_TZ}
  85. fi
  86. done
  87. MEM_TOTAL=$(awk '/MemTotal/ {print $2}' /proc/meminfo)
  88. if [ ${MEM_TOTAL} -le "2621440" ]; then
  89. echo "Installed memory is <= 2.5 GiB. It is recommended to disable ClamAV to prevent out-of-memory situations."
  90. echo "ClamAV can be re-enabled by setting SKIP_CLAMD=n in mailcow.conf."
  91. read -r -p "Do you want to disable ClamAV now? [Y/n] " response
  92. case $response in
  93. [nN][oO]|[nN])
  94. SKIP_CLAMD=n
  95. ;;
  96. *)
  97. SKIP_CLAMD=y
  98. ;;
  99. esac
  100. else
  101. SKIP_CLAMD=n
  102. fi
  103. if [ ${MEM_TOTAL} -le "2097152" ]; then
  104. echo "Disabling Solr on low-memory system."
  105. SKIP_SOLR=y
  106. elif [ ${MEM_TOTAL} -le "3670016" ]; then
  107. echo "Installed memory is <= 3.5 GiB. It is recommended to disable Solr to prevent out-of-memory situations."
  108. echo "Solr is a prone to run OOM and should be monitored. The default Solr heap size is 1024 MiB and should be set in mailcow.conf according to your expected load."
  109. echo "Solr can be re-enabled by setting SKIP_SOLR=n in mailcow.conf but will refuse to start with less than 2 GB total memory."
  110. read -r -p "Do you want to disable Solr now? [Y/n] " response
  111. case $response in
  112. [nN][oO]|[nN])
  113. SKIP_SOLR=n
  114. ;;
  115. *)
  116. SKIP_SOLR=y
  117. ;;
  118. esac
  119. else
  120. SKIP_SOLR=n
  121. fi

  123. [ ! -f ./data/conf/rspamd/override.d/worker-controller-password.inc ] && echo '# Placeholder' > ./data/conf/rspamd/override.d/worker-controller-password.inc
  124. cat << EOF > mailcow.conf
  125. # ------------------------------
  126. # mailcow web ui configuration
  127. # ------------------------------
  128. # example.org is _not_ a valid hostname, use a fqdn here.
  129. # Default admin user is "admin"
  130. # Default password is "moohoo"
  131. MAILCOW_HOSTNAME=${MAILCOW_HOSTNAME}
  132. # Password hash algorithm
  133. # Only certain password hash algorithm are supported. For a fully list of supported schemes,
  134. # see https://mailcow.github.io/mailcow-dockerized-docs/models/model-passwd/
  135. MAILCOW_PASS_SCHEME=BLF-CRYPT
  136. # ------------------------------
  137. # SQL database configuration
  138. # ------------------------------
  139. DBNAME=mailcow
  140. DBUSER=mailcow
  141. # Please use long, random alphanumeric strings (A-Za-z0-9)
  142. DBPASS=$(LC_ALL=C </dev/urandom tr -dc A-Za-z0-9 | head -c 28)
  143. DBROOT=$(LC_ALL=C </dev/urandom tr -dc A-Za-z0-9 | head -c 28)
  144. # ------------------------------
  145. # HTTP/S Bindings
  146. # ------------------------------
  147. # You should use HTTPS, but in case of SSL offloaded reverse proxies:
  148. # Might be important: This will also change the binding within the container.
  149. # If you use a proxy within Docker, point it to the ports you set below.
  150. # Do _not_ use IP:PORT in HTTP(S)_BIND or HTTP(S)_PORT
  151. # IMPORTANT: Do not use port 8081, 9081 or 65510!
  152. # Example: HTTP_BIND=1.2.3.4
  153. # For IPv4 leave it as it is: HTTP_BIND= & HTTPS_PORT=
  154. # For IPv6 see https://mailcow.github.io/mailcow-dockerized-docs/post_installation/firststeps-ip_bindings/
  155. HTTP_PORT=80
  156. HTTP_BIND=
  157. HTTPS_PORT=443
  158. HTTPS_BIND=
  159. # ------------------------------
  160. # Other bindings
  161. # ------------------------------
  162. # You should leave that alone
  163. # Format: 11.22.33.44:25 or 12.34.56.78:465 etc.
  164. SMTP_PORT=25
  165. SMTPS_PORT=465
  166. SUBMISSION_PORT=587
  167. IMAP_PORT=143
  168. IMAPS_PORT=993
  169. POP_PORT=110
  170. POPS_PORT=995
  171. SIEVE_PORT=4190
  172. DOVEADM_PORT=127.0.0.1:19991
  173. SQL_PORT=127.0.0.1:13306
  174. SOLR_PORT=127.0.0.1:18983
  175. REDIS_PORT=127.0.0.1:7654
  176. # Your timezone
  177. # See https://en.wikipedia.org/wiki/List_of_tz_database_time_zones for a list of timezones
  178. # Use the row named 'TZ database name' + pay attention for 'Notes' row
  179. TZ=${MAILCOW_TZ}
  180. # Fixed project name
  181. # Please use lowercase letters only
  182. COMPOSE_PROJECT_NAME=mailcowdockerized
  183. # Used Docker Compose version
  184. # Switch here between native (compose plugin) and standalone
  185. # For more informations take a look at the mailcow docs regarding the configuration options.
  186. DOCKER_COMPOSE_VERSION=${COMPOSE_VERSION}
  187. # Set this to "allow" to enable the anyone pseudo user. Disabled by default.
  188. # When enabled, ACL can be created, that apply to "All authenticated users"
  189. # This should probably only be activated on mail hosts, that are used exclusivly by one organisation.
  190. # Otherwise a user might share data with too many other users.
  191. ACL_ANYONE=disallow
  192. # Garbage collector cleanup
  193. # Deleted domains and mailboxes are moved to /var/vmail/_garbage/timestamp_sanitizedstring
  194. # How long should objects remain in the garbage until they are being deleted? (value in minutes)
  195. # Check interval is hourly
  196. MAILDIR_GC_TIME=7200
  197. # Additional SAN for the certificate
  198. #
  199. # You can use wildcard records to create specific names for every domain you add to mailcow.
  200. # Example: Add domains "example.com" and "example.net" to mailcow, change ADDITIONAL_SAN to a value like:
  201. #ADDITIONAL_SAN=imap.*,smtp.*
  202. # This will expand the certificate to "imap.example.com", "smtp.example.com", "imap.example.net", "smtp.example.net"
  203. # plus every domain you add in the future.
  204. #
  205. # You can also just add static names...
  206. #ADDITIONAL_SAN=srv1.example.net
  207. # ...or combine wildcard and static names:
  208. #ADDITIONAL_SAN=imap.*,srv1.example.com
  209. #
  210. ADDITIONAL_SAN=
  211. # Additional server names for mailcow UI
  212. #
  213. # Specify alternative addresses for the mailcow UI to respond to
  214. # This is useful when you set mail.* as ADDITIONAL_SAN and want to make sure mail.maildomain.com will always point to the mailcow UI.
  215. # If the server name does not match a known site, Nginx decides by best-guess and may redirect users to the wrong web root.
  216. # You can understand this as server_name directive in Nginx.
  217. # Comma separated list without spaces! Example: ADDITIONAL_SERVER_NAMES=a.b.c,d.e.f
  218. ADDITIONAL_SERVER_NAMES=
  219. # Skip running ACME (acme-mailcow, Let's Encrypt certs) - y/n
  220. SKIP_LETS_ENCRYPT=n
  221. # Create seperate certificates for all domains - y/n
  222. # this will allow adding more than 100 domains, but some email clients will not be able to connect with alternative hostnames
  223. # see https://wiki.dovecot.org/SSL/SNIClientSupport
  224. ENABLE_SSL_SNI=n
  225. # Skip IPv4 check in ACME container - y/n
  226. SKIP_IP_CHECK=n
  227. # Skip HTTP verification in ACME container - y/n
  228. SKIP_HTTP_VERIFICATION=n
  229. # Skip ClamAV (clamd-mailcow) anti-virus (Rspamd will auto-detect a missing ClamAV container) - y/n
  230. SKIP_CLAMD=${SKIP_CLAMD}
  231. # Skip SOGo: Will disable SOGo integration and therefore webmail, DAV protocols and ActiveSync support (experimental, unsupported, not fully implemented) - y/n
  232. SKIP_SOGO=n
  233. # Skip Solr on low-memory systems or if you do not want to store a readable index of your mails in solr-vol-1.
  234. SKIP_SOLR=${SKIP_SOLR}
  235. # Solr heap size in MB, there is no recommendation, please see Solr docs.
  236. # Solr is a prone to run OOM and should be monitored. Unmonitored Solr setups are not recommended.
  237. SOLR_HEAP=1024
  238. # Allow admins to log into SOGo as email user (without any password)
  239. ALLOW_ADMIN_EMAIL_LOGIN=n
  240. # Enable watchdog (watchdog-mailcow) to restart unhealthy containers
  241. USE_WATCHDOG=y
  242. # Send watchdog notifications by mail (sent from watchdog@MAILCOW_HOSTNAME)
  243. # CAUTION:
  244. # 1. You should use external recipients
  245. # 2. Mails are sent unsigned (no DKIM)
  246. # 3. If you use DMARC, create a separate DMARC policy ("v=DMARC1; p=none;" in _dmarc.MAILCOW_HOSTNAME)
  247. # Multiple rcpts allowed, NO quotation marks, NO spaces
  248. #WATCHDOG_NOTIFY_EMAIL=a@example.com,b@example.com,c@example.com
  249. #WATCHDOG_NOTIFY_EMAIL=
  250. # Notify about banned IP (includes whois lookup)
  251. WATCHDOG_NOTIFY_BAN=n
  252. # Subject for watchdog mails. Defaults to "Watchdog ALERT" followed by the error message.
  253. #WATCHDOG_SUBJECT=
  254. # Checks if mailcow is an open relay. Requires a SAL. More checks will follow.
  255. # https://www.servercow.de/mailcow?lang=en
  256. # https://www.servercow.de/mailcow?lang=de
  257. # No data is collected. Opt-in and anonymous.
  258. # Will only work with unmodified mailcow setups.
  259. WATCHDOG_EXTERNAL_CHECKS=n
  260. # Enable watchdog verbose logging
  261. WATCHDOG_VERBOSE=n
  262. # Max log lines per service to keep in Redis logs
  263. LOG_LINES=9999
  264. # Internal IPv4 /24 subnet, format n.n.n (expands to n.n.n.0/24)
  265. # Use private IPv4 addresses only, see https://en.wikipedia.org/wiki/Private_network#Private_IPv4_addresses
  266. IPV4_NETWORK=172.22.1
  267. # Internal IPv6 subnet in fc00::/7
  268. # Use private IPv6 addresses only, see https://en.wikipedia.org/wiki/Private_network#Private_IPv6_addresses
  269. IPV6_NETWORK=fd4d:6169:6c63:6f77::/64
  270. # Use this IPv4 for outgoing connections (SNAT)
  271. #SNAT_TO_SOURCE=
  272. # Use this IPv6 for outgoing connections (SNAT)
  273. #SNAT6_TO_SOURCE=
  274. # Create or override an API key for the web UI
  275. # You _must_ define API_ALLOW_FROM, which is a comma separated list of IPs
  276. # An API key defined as API_KEY has read-write access
  277. # An API key defined as API_KEY_READ_ONLY has read-only access
  278. # Allowed chars for API_KEY and API_KEY_READ_ONLY: a-z, A-Z, 0-9, -
  279. # You can define API_KEY and/or API_KEY_READ_ONLY
  280. #API_KEY=
  281. #API_KEY_READ_ONLY=
  282. #API_ALLOW_FROM=172.22.1.1,127.0.0.1
  283. # mail_home is ~/Maildir
  284. MAILDIR_SUB=Maildir
  285. # SOGo session timeout in minutes
  286. SOGO_EXPIRE_SESSION=480
  287. # DOVECOT_MASTER_USER and DOVECOT_MASTER_PASS must both be provided. No special chars.
  288. # Empty by default to auto-generate master user and password on start.
  289. # User expands to DOVECOT_MASTER_USER@mailcow.local
  290. # LEAVE EMPTY IF UNSURE
  291. DOVECOT_MASTER_USER=
  292. # LEAVE EMPTY IF UNSURE
  293. DOVECOT_MASTER_PASS=
  294. # Let's Encrypt registration contact information
  295. # Optional: Leave empty for none
  296. # This value is only used on first order!
  297. # Setting it at a later point will require the following steps:
  298. # https://mailcow.github.io/mailcow-dockerized-docs/troubleshooting/debug-reset_tls/
  299. ACME_CONTACT=
  300. # WebAuthn device manufacturer verification
  301. # After setting WEBAUTHN_ONLY_TRUSTED_VENDORS=y only devices from trusted manufacturers are allowed
  302. # root certificates can be placed for validation under mailcow-dockerized/data/web/inc/lib/WebAuthn/rootCertificates
  303. WEBAUTHN_ONLY_TRUSTED_VENDORS=n
  304. EOF
